          Considerations for Migrating Decision Tables

          Considerations for Migrating Decision Tables

          Before you plan to migrate a decision table from a source org to a target org, review the migration considerations.

          Required Editions

          Available in: Lightning Experience
          Available in: Enterprise, Unlimited, and Developer Editions for clouds that have Business Rules Engine enabled
          Important
          Important If you use custom fields in your decision table, you can’t migrate the table from one Salesforce org to another using Package Manager in a single step.
          Note
          Note Before deploying changes to the metadata of a decision table in an org where the decision table already exists, you must deactivate the decision table in the target org. Ensure that you use separate deployment steps to remove a decision table parameter, and activate the decision table.
          Note
          Note After you upload a CSV file to a CSV-based decision table in the target org, you can't deploy changes to the metadata of that decision table.

          Here’s how you can migrate decision tables that use custom fields:

          • First, migrate the custom fields in your decision table to the target org by using Package Manager.
          • Next, verify that the custom fields are present in the target org.
          • Finally, migrate the decision table by using Package Manager.
